Karl Towns, top-rated player in 2015 class, to visit UNC Wednesday


According to multiple reports, center (Metuchen, NJ), Scout.com's top-rated player in the 2015 recruiting class, will visit UNC on Wednesday. He will follow up that visit with trips to Duke and possibly NC State on Thursday. Despite his young age, Towns participated as a member of the Dominican national team this summer, gaining valuable experience and playing against some of the world's top players.

One advantage UNC may have in Towns' recruitment is that he is personal friends with current UNC guard . However, Towns' Dominican national team was coached by Kentucky head coach John Calipari, making Kentucky one of the top contenders at this point.
